Indeed. It seems that TruthByDecree is trying to make the following argument, or something very like it:

  • If something is fringe, then it will be or should be completely ignored.
  • 9/11 conspiracy theories are not completely ignored.
  • Therefore, they are not fringe, but rather mainstream.
  • Therefore, they are legitimate.
It is an obvious non sequitur, however. (Holocaust denial, for example, is undoubtedly fringe pseudohistory. But it is not completely ignored*; nor necessarily should it be. This doesn’t mean, however, that Holocaust denial is somehow mainstream or legitimate.)

* Of course, it is ignored – and probably rightly so – by the vast majority of mainstream academia, just as are 9/11 conspiracy theories.
